Download a sticker maker app like (by Viko & Co) or use WhatsApp Web's built-in sticker creator . Select "Create a New Sticker Pack." Upload the image or screenshot you want to use.
If you have a funny photo of a friend or a local meme, you can turn it into a sticker directly in WhatsApp. Use the Built-in Sticker Maker (Mobile) Open a WhatsApp chat. Tap the > Sticker icon . Tap the "+" or "Create" button. Select a photo from your gallery.
